The electrochemical reduction of chloromethyldimethylchlorosilane affords polycarbosilanes in high yields and this route constitutes a competitive route to 1,1,3,3-tetramethyl-1,3-disilacyclobutane formed in 34percent crude yield.The solvent mixture was varied to yield its precursor, Cl(CH2SiMe2)2Cl, in 43percent yield after distillation, while electrosynthesis in the presence of dimethyldichlorosilane provided bis(dimethyl-chlorosilyl)methane, another polycarbosilane precursor, in 60percent yield after distillation.
